MORE ABOUT THE DEGREE

The Machine Learning Specialization is oriented to the design, development and testing of new techniques and processes for professional application, which responds to demands from social and productive sectors, public and private.


The activities to be developed include scientific training disciplines along with other units that broaden the conceptual framework of the problems raised.

It is based on the Machine Learning and Computational Statistics courses that are part of the MicroMaster in Statistics and Data Science offered by MITx through the edX platform with weekly support from facilitators from MIT and UTEC. In turn, an intensive 4-week workshop is held with MIT in Uruguay (date subject to sanitary conditions). In the Specialization, a final monographic work is required, on a topic of your choice, focused on the analysis and review of existing bibliography, in addition to the presentation of your personal point of view on the subject, linked to the methods and tools learned.

Registrations can be made until June 25, 2021. The semi-face-to-face diploma begins on July 5, 2021 with an estimated average dedication of 20 hours per week and a price of USD 4,200 (Early bird 10% off until June 14) . The curricular activities associated with the Diploma comprise a total of 58 credits, which according to the General Regulations for Studies of the UTEC represents 870 chronological hours, which implies that the student must dedicate an average of 20 hours per week to its completion.

The demand for specialists with machine learning knowledge is on the rise both locally and regionally. The Specialization in Machine Learning aims to train its participants in the development of computational solutions that use machine learning. The graduate will develop a technical vision that will allow him to identify problems or areas of opportunity related to data analysis through the use of technological tools. You will be able to apply descriptive, diagnostic and predictive analytical methodologies to optimize productive, administrative, financial and / or technological processes, in addition to promoting decision-making based on specific facts and data. From a technical point of view, graduates will be able to:

  • analyze large volumes of data
  • pose mathematical models and use statistical tools to make predictions based on data
  • identify and develop suitable models and methodologies to extract meaningful information for decision making
  • develop and build machine learning algorithms to extract meaningful information from seemingly unstructured data
  • apply unsupervised learning methods, including data clustering and neural network methodologies
